General description

Protein delta homolog 1or DLK-1 (DLK1), also known as pG2 and the Preadipocyte factor-1 (Pref-1), is a single pass type 1 membrane protein known to play a steering role in neuroendocrine differentiation. The protein is expressed within the stromal cells in contact with the vascular structure of the placental villi, yok sac, fetal liver, adrenal cortex and pancreas during development and DLK1 is also expressed within the beta cells of the islets of Langerhans in the adult. DLK1 plays an important gene regulatory expression role during the development of not only these very early structures but also in the regulation of the development of many specialized cells and tissues such as adipocytes. In adipose tissue, DLK1/Pref-1 is specifically expressed in preadipocytes but not in adipocytes and thus can be used as a preadipocyte marker. The inhibition operates through the creation of a soluble cleaved cytoplasmic form of DLK1 via the action of the metalloproteinase ADAM17 on mature DLK1. Fetal Antigen 1 (FA1) or soluble DLK-1/Pref-1 activates the MAPK kinase/ERK pathway, and via Sox9 interactions ultimately inhibits the differentiation of pre-adipocytes into mature adipocytes. Furthermore, by inducing Sox9, Pref-1 promotes chondrogenic induction of mesenchymal cells but prevents chondrocyte maturation as well as osteoblast differentiation. Thus, DLK1/Pref-1 directs multipotent mesenchymal cells (MSCs) toward the chondrogenic lineage but inhibits differentiation into adipocytes as well as osteoblasts and chondrocytes. Naturally, DLK1 has multiple isoforms each with slightly differing but related influences on MSCs development. Finally, DLK1 is also expressed in various tumors including small cell lung carcinoma and numerous neuroendocrine cancers.
